Basement Sump Pump Service in Des Moines, IA

Basement sump pump services focus on installing, maintaining, and repairing sump pumps that protect homes from flooding and water damage. These systems are typically installed in the lowest part of a basement or crawl space to automatically remove excess water that accumulates due to heavy rain, groundwater seepage, or plumbing leaks. Projects often involve evaluating existing sump pump systems, upgrading outdated units, or installing new pumps to ensure reliable operation. Homeowners should understand the importance of a properly functioning sump pump in preventing basement flooding and water-related issues,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or high water tables.

Before requesting sump pump services, property owners usually want to know about the different types of sump pumps available, such as pedestal or submersible models, and which options are best suited for their home’s needs. It’s also helpful to understand the typical signs of a failing sump pump, like unusual noises or frequent cycling, and the importance of regular maintenance to ensure continued performance. Clarifying the scope of work, including potential upgrades or system replacements, can help homeowners make informed decisions about safeguarding their basement from water damage.

FAQ

Basement Sump Pump Service Questions

What is a sump pump and how does it work? A sump pump is a device installed in the basement to remove excess water, preventing flooding and water damage during heavy rains or groundwater seepage.

When should a sump pump be serviced or replaced? Regular inspections are recommended to ensure proper operation, and replacement may be needed if the pump shows signs of failure or frequent malfunctions.

What are common signs of sump pump failure? Signs include frequent cycling, strange noises, or water accumulating in the sump pit despite the pump running.

How can property owners maintain their sump pumps? Maintenance includes clearing debris, testing the pump periodically, and ensuring the discharge pipe is free of obstructions.
